What NordVPN Threat Protection actually does
Threat Protection works at the DNS and application level, actively blocking known harmful content rather than reacting after something goes wrong.
Key protections include:
- Blocking malicious websites before they load
- Stopping phishing pages designed to steal logins or financial details
- Preventing malware downloads, even if you click a bad link
- Reducing invasive ads and trackers across the web
Unlike traditional antivirus software, Threat Protection doesn’t rely solely on scanning files after download. It focuses on prevention, which is often the most effective form of security.
Always-on protection, even without VPN connection
- One of Threat Protection’s standout features is that parts of it work even when you’re not connected to a VPN server. This means:
- You still get malicious website blocking on trusted home networks
- Ads and trackers can be filtered without slowing your connection
- Downloads are checked regardless of location
For everyday browsing, this makes it far more practical than tools that only activate during VPN sessions.

How it fits into a broader security setup
NordVPN Threat Protection isn’t meant to replace everything. Instead, it works best as part of a layered approach:
- VPN encryption protects your connection
- Threat Protection blocks malicious content and tracking
- Good passwords and updates reduce account risks
Together, these form a balanced and practical security setup for everyday internet use.
